Transmission ??

First i would like to say hello to all,New member here, I just bought a 04 f150 2 wheel drive supercab 48k 4.6 I have had it for about a month. I backed it out of the garage and accidently put the truck in 2nd gear to go up an small incline and the truck did not want to move I had the gas pedal half way to the floor and the engine was taching but hardly any movement. As soon as i put in drive it took off. I took the truck back to the dealer and they said it is normal for f150s. So help me, is this normal or am i getting ripped off because the 30 day warranty on drive train expired the day i discovered this. Any advise would be helpful..Thanks

Starting in 2nd means just that. 2nd gear instead of 1st, supposed to feel like a slug. Good to use in snow or mud, does not apply the torque that a first gear start would.
